Product Overview
The THS4509RGTT is a wideband fully-differential Operational Amplifier designed for 5V data acquisition systems. It has a low noise at 1.9nV/√Hz and low harmonic distortion of -75dBc HD2 and -80dBc HD3 at 100MHz with 2VPP, G=10dB and 1kΩ load. Slew rate is high at 6600V/μs and with settling time of 2ns to 1% (2V step), it is ideal for pulsed applications. It is designed for a minimum gain of 6dB, but is optimized for gains of 10dB. To allow for DC coupling to analog-to-digital converters (ADCs), its unique output common-mode control circuit maintains the output common-mode voltage within 3mV offset (typical) from the set voltage, when set within 0.5V of mid-supply, with less than 4mV differential offset voltage. The common-mode set point is set to mid-supply by internal circuitry, which may be overdriven from an external source. The input and output are optimized for best performance with the common-mode voltages set to mid-supply.
